概述
服务器是一个虚拟游戏平台,通过网络连接让玩家可以在线进行多种游戏,如扑克、斗地主等。然而,正是由于其在线性质,使得服务器成为黑客攻击的目标。本文将介绍一种针对服务器的攻击方法,通过图解来详细展示攻击流程。
准备工作
在进行服务器的攻击之前,需要进行一些准备工作。,需要搭建一个本地的测试环境,模拟服务器的运行环境。,需要安装一些相关的工具,如Wireshark用于网络数据包的抓取和分析,以及Burp Suite用于HTTP数据包的拦截和修改。
攻击流程
1. 探测目标服务器:,通过扫描目标服务器的IP地址和端口号,确认其所运行的服务器应用程序。可以使用nmap等工具进行目标服务器的信息搜集。
2. 抓包分析通信协议:通过Wireshark工具抓取目标服务器和客户端之间的通信数据包,分析其通信协议和数据格式。
3. 破解数据包加密:如果通信数据包使用了加密算法进行传输,需要使用Burp Suite等工具来对数据包进行解密,以获取明文数据。
4. 修改数据包内容:在了解了通信协议和数据格式之后,可以尝试修改数据包的内容,如篡改玩家的游戏数据或者注入恶意代码。
5. 发起攻击:通过修改后的数据包,向目标服务器发送恶意请求,触发服务器的漏洞或者绕过服务器的安全机制,来实现攻击的目的。
防御措施
为了保护服务器不受攻击,可以采取一些防御措施:
1. 对网络通信进行加密:使用SSL/TLS等加密协议,保护通信数据的安全性,防止被窃取或篡改。
2. 对数据包进行校验:在服务器端对接收到的数据包进行校验,验证其完整性和合法性,防止恶意数据包的注入。
3. 定期更新服务器软件:及时安装补丁和更新软件版本,修复已知漏洞,提高服务器的安全性。
4. 进行安全审计:定期对服务器进行安全审计和漏洞扫描,及时发现并修复潜在的安全风险。
5. 限制访问权限:设定访问控制策略,只允许合法的用户和设备访问服务器,减少攻击的可能性。
结论
通过本文的介绍,我们了解了针对服务器的攻击方法和防御措施。在今后的实践中,我们应该加强对网络安全的意识,提高服务器的安全性,保护用户的游戏数据和隐私信息。同时,也要密切关注最新的安全漏洞和攻击技术,及时采取相应的应对措施,确保服务器的稳定和安全运行。